ReplyDeleteJennifer, these are the five simple potato dishes I usually use: Mashed Potatoes, Baked Potatoes, Oven Baked Potato Wedges, potato pancakes and Hasselback Potatoes:
DeleteOven Baked Potato Wedges:
Just cut the potatoes into wedges, and mix them up with som EVO and your favorite herb mix plus a little salt.
Hasselback Potatoes: Cut lines half way through the potatoes and season with some EVO and herbs. You can see a post I did many years ago about making Hasselback Potatoes.
